1.

An object will accelerate when:

2.

When a net force acts on an object, its acceleration is dependent upon the object's

3.

If the forces on an object are balanced, what is its acceleration?

4.

A baseball with a mass of 5 kg is hit with a force of 400 N. How fast does it accelerate?

8.

A 1500 kg car accelerates at a rate of 2 m/s². What is the net force acting on the car?

9.

A 5 kg object is dropped and is in free fall (acceleration is 10 m/s²). What is the net force acting on the object?

10.

An unknown force is applied to a 5.0 kg object, causing it to accelerate at 8.0 m/s². What is the magnitude of the force?

11.

An object with an unknown mass accelerates at 4.0 m/s² when a 24 N force is applied to it. What is the mass of the object?

12.

A 2 kg object is moving at a constant speed of 5 m/s. What is the net force acting on it?
